As the year comes to an end due to holidays and vacations, many companies encounter a slowdown of manufacturing or at times even a temporary shutdown. Many processors utilize this period of time for maintaining their molds and facility. As a result the plastic processors will look into mold storage products (long term and short term preventives), mold and machine components, mold cleaners, and many other products that are required for their specific needs.

Processors are also nearing the end for their yearly budget. With any available budget that remains, several processors look into equipment purchases for a variety of reasons. Automation of their processes is carefully scrutinized to improve their efficiencies. Many facilities also look into repairing worn screws, barrels, or pieces of equipment if it is more beneficial than buying new.

IMS wants to remind our customers that once their facilities start back up, make sure to remember to soft start your machines. It is more common than most people think to cold start your machine. This practice greatly increases the chance for heater bands to fail, screws to bend, tips to snap, and a host of other problems that could occur.
